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Zenoh loads plugins from system libraries before the current directory #824

Closed
fuzzypixelz opened this issue Mar 13, 2024 · 0 comments · Fixed by #825
Closed

Zenoh loads plugins from system libraries before the current directory #824

fuzzypixelz opened this issue Mar 13, 2024 · 0 comments · Fixed by #825
Labels
release Part of the next release

Comments

@fuzzypixelz
Copy link
Member

fuzzypixelz commented Mar 13, 2024

Describe the release item

The default plugin search path is /usr/local/lib:/usr/lib:/opt/homebrew/lib:~/.zenoh/lib:. which looks into system libraries before the user's home and before the current directory.

If one has a plugin installed into /opt/homebrew/lib (e.g. when using homebrew-zenoh), and they try to run zenohd after compiling from source, then Zenoh will load the wrong plugin and most likely fail to incompatibilities between versions.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
release Part of the next release
Projects
Status: Done
Development

Successfully merging a pull request may close this issue.

1 participant